Hawaiian officials confirm at least 36 people have been killed in fast-moving wildfires with hundreds of buildings damaged or destroyed on the island of Maui. Ilihia Gionson, public affairs officer for the Hawaii Tourism Authority, joined CBS News to discuss the situation.
